Access Softek is seeking a Strategic Partnership Manager to manage our established fintech partner ecosystem. This role is responsible for the day-to-day health of our partner relationships, internal team enablement, and the operational rhythm that keeps our new ecosystem running at full speed across 100+ credit union clients.
This position reports directly to the Head of Product and will operate with strong leadership support, executive oversight on strategic decisions, and access to an established industry network to draw on.
Responsibilities include:
Partner Relationship Management
Own the day-to-day relationships with assigned fintech and technology partners across the Access Digital ecosystem
Run bi-weekly/monthly partner calls, track action items, and keep communication consistent and productive
Monitor partner product updates, roadmap changes, and API or integration developments — surfacing what matters to our internal teams
Escalate strategically complex issues or major commercial decisions to leadership oversight
Sales & Account Management Enablement
Serve as the internal product expert for partner solutions — the go-to resource for Sales and Account Management teams
Support AMs in identifying cross-sell opportunities across the client base
Facilitate partner training sessions, onboarding materials, and lunch-and-learns for internal teams, and ensure new sales reporting to partners respectively
Contribute to the Partner Playbook and AM Rules of Engagement to keep field teams sharp, savvy, and confident
Commercial & Operational Support
Manage routine commercial tasks including pricing approvals, discount requests, contract renewals, and contract administrative items
Support renewal coordination and partner tier management within the Access Digital Partner Marketplace
Track partner performance metrics and flag trends to leadership
Coordinate and aid Product and Implementation on partner integration issues and any client-facing escalations
Partner Ecosystem Coverage:
This role will manage relationships across Access Digital’s established partner stack, including:
Payments: Bill pay, P2P, FedNow, RTP, and disbursements
Fraud & Risk: Biometric, OFAC/AML/KYC, and identity verification
Lending & Account Opening: Embedded lending and origination solutions
Cards & Card Services: Digital issuance, card management, and controls
Core Banking Integrations: Corelation, Jack Henry, FiServ, and other core partners
Member Engagement & Financial Wellness: Credit, financial health, growth, and personalization
Marketing & AI: Content management, business banking intelligence, conversational banking, video chat, and AI-assisted services (e.g., Uptiq, Glia)
Data & Compliance: Open banking and compliance infrastructure

About the Company:
Access Softek started developing software 30 years ago in Berkeley, California. Now, we have offices all over the United States and around the world, and are growing by the day! Our software is in use by over 350+ financial institutions, helping them to reach millions of customers and shape communities across the country. In addition, we have a technical development and consulting division that works for companies like Google, Sony and Nintendo.
